"A favorite of the Mount Pleasant set, Bacco is a welcoming space where diners go to enjoy a hearty rigatoni with braised beef ragu or chicken parmigiana over pasta. Chef Michael Scognamiglio is known for his seafood dishes and is celebrated for his Feast of the Seven Fishes around the holidays." - Erin Perkins

So you're in Mt. Pleasant for the weekend and it's late -- late enough that a lot of restaurants are starting to close soon. Not really sure what to eat but you could always go for a slice (or two)? One restaurant, two words. La pizzeria. Nestled into the corner of a strip mall, inside this cute little restaurant is a cozy little front section adjacent to the register, stacked dessert case and the giant pizza oven you see as you walk in. I noticed they also have additional seating in another dining room to the right (though we chose to carry out vs dining in). As a lover of gourmet pizza, I always get excited when I see a sicilian or grandma type of pizza on the menu -- or anything thick, square cut, and with crispy edges. We tried to order online but quickly got stopped. One quick phone call later, we discovered that you can only place Sicilian pizza orders over the phone or in person because they only make a certain amount of those pizzas per day. Having never been here before I wasn't sure if this pizza would be large enough to adequately feed two pizza lovers without being hungry afterwards -- spoiler, alert: it was. The guy on the phone informed me that the pizza is 16 x 16 and this pizza was fairly giant. He was super helpful as a first time customer, explaining that we needed several boxes as even a large standard to go box would only fit about one slice of pizza. We went with the Pomodoro pizza (as pictured) which turned out into eight giant but equally delicious slices. It's not often when you increase the size of the pizza, the quality also increases at the same rate but this place nailed it. This particular pizza was a little pricy at about $28 before tax ($31 total) but considering the size you can definitely get several meals out of it. The photo doesn't do it justice because one slice of pizza is about the size of a person's forearm. This was the first visit but will not be our last.
